Understanding Women’s Bike Anatomy

Before diving into the specifics mounting womens bike on bike rack so it is important to have a basic knowledge of about how to mount womens bike on bike rack anatomy. Unlike men’s bikes, women’s bikes often have a lower top tube, allowing for easier mounting and dismounting. Additionally, women’s bikes may have different frame geometries and dimensions, which can affect compatibility with certain bike racks. Familiarizing yourself with the unique features of a women’s bike will be helpful when choosing the right bike rack and mounting technique.

Bike Racks Types

There are different bike rack types available in market every with its own set of benefits and considerations. It is important to choose a bike rack that is compatible with women’s bikes and suits your specific needs. Following are some common bike racks types:

1. Hitch-mounted bike racks:

  • Compatible with most women’s bikes.
  • Offers strong and secure attachment.
  • Requires a hitch receiver on your vehicle.

2. Trunk-mounted bike racks:

  • Can accommodate women’s bikes with adjustable arms.
  • Lightweight and easy to install.
  • May require extra support straps for stability.

3. Roof-mounted bike racks:

  • Suitable for women’s bikes with a standard frame design.
  • Provides clear access to the trunk.
  • The bike should be lifted onto the roof of the vehicle.

Here Are Step by step instructions on How To Mount Womens Bike on Bike Rack

Follow these step-by-step instructions to successfully mount your women’s bike on a bike rack:

  1. Choose the right bike for your women’s bike and car considering compatibility and ease of installation.
  2. Position your bike rack on the vehicle, ensuring a secure fit and proper alignment with the bike’s frame.
  3. If your women’s bike has a non-traditional frame design, such as a step-through or full-suspension frame, attach a bike frame adapter bar for added stability and compatibility.
  4. Place the women’s bike onto the bike rack, aligning the top tube or adapter bar with the designated attachment points.
  5. Securely fasten the bike onto the rack using the provided straps or clamps. Double-check for proper attachment and stability.
  6. Test the firmness of the bike rack by gently shaking the bike from different angles. If the bike remains secure, you’re ready to hit the road!

Safety Precautions

While mounting a women’s bike on a bike rack, it’s essential to prioritize safety. Here are some essential safety precautions to keep in your mind:

  • Make sure the bike rack is properly installed and secured according to the manufacturer’s instructions.
  • Double-check the attachment points and straps to ensure they are tight and secure.
  • Always mount the bike rack in a well-lit area to ensure visibility.
  • Avoid obstructing the vehicle’s taillights or license plate with the bike or bike rack.
  • Regularly inspect bike racks & trails for signs of wear & damage.

Troubleshooting Common Challenges

Mounting a women’s bike on a bike rack may encounter some challenges along the way. Here are some general issues & their possible solutions:

Issue: The bike rack doesn’t fit the women’s bike.

Solution: Consider using a bike frame adapter bar to achieve a secure fit.

Issue: The bike wobbles or feels unstable on the rack.

Solution: Double-check the attachment points and straps, ensuring they are properly tightened.

Issue: The bike obstructs the vehicle’s taillights or license plate.

Solution: Adjust the placement of the bike rack and bike to ensure proper visibility.

Q: Are bike frame adapter bars necessary for all women’s bikes?

A: Bike frame adapter bars are generally required for women’s bikes with non-traditional frame designs, such as step-through or full-suspension frames. Stability and compatibility with a variety of bike setups are enhanced.

Q: What are any additional considerations for women electric bikes?

A: Yes, electric bikes generally weigh more than traditional bikes. Ensure that the bike rack you choose has a sufficient weight capacity to support your electric women’s bike.
